ASP连接MySQL远程服务器技术实现分析
ASP连接MySQL远程服务器是一种常见的技术方案,可以让用户通过web应用程序来操作MySQL数据库,获得更好的用户体验。本文将介绍ASP连接MySQL远程服务器的实现方式,并提供相关代码实现。
一、MySQL远程连接的基本原理
MySQL是一款开源的关系型数据库管理系统,支持多种编程语言进行数据库连接。在远程连接MySQL数据库时,用户需要在MySQL服务器端开启远程访问权限,并在客户端使用正确的IP地址和端口号进行连接。
二、ASP连接MySQL远程服务器技术实现
ASP是一种为动态web应用程序开发的技术,可以与多种数据库进行交互。如果想要在ASP中连接MySQL远程服务器,主要需要以下几个步骤:
1. 获取MySQL连接字符串
在ASP中,用户需要获取一个有效的MySQL连接字符串,以确保能够成功连接MySQL数据库。这个连接字符串包含 MySQL服务器的IP地址、端口、用户名、密码以及数据库名称等信息。用户需要先创建一个变量,然后将这些信息组合起来,即可得到有效的MySQL连接字符串。
2. 使用ADODB对象连接MySQL数据库
通过在ASP代码中创建ADODB对象,用户可以使用VBScript语言连接MySQL数据库。通过ADODB对象,用户可以使用各种数据访问技术,包括ODBC、OLE DB和OLE DB Provider for MySQL等。
3. 执行SQL语句
在MySQL数据库中,用户可以使用SQL语言执行各种操作,包括查询、更新、删除等。在连接MySQL远程服务器时,用户可以使用ASP代码执行SQL语句,以操作MySQL数据库中的数据。
三、ASP连接MySQL远程服务器代码实现
在ASP代码中,用户需要编写以下代码来连接MySQL远程服务器:
<%
Dim conn_string, conn
conn_string = “Driver={MySQL ODBC 3.51 Driver};Server=xx.xx.xx.xx;Database=mydatabase;User=myuser;Password=mypassword;Option=3;”
Set conn = Server.CreateObject(“ADODB.Connection”)
conn.Open conn_string
%>
代码说明:
1. 在上面的代码中,用户首先创建一个变量conn_string,该变量包含了MySQL远程服务器的IP地址、端口、用户名、密码以及数据库名称等信息。
2. 接着,用户使用Server.CreateObject方法创建ADODB.Connection对象conn。
3. 用户调用conn.Open方法打开MySQL数据库连接。
通过上述代码实现,用户可以通过ASP代码连接 MySQL远程服务器,实现MySQL数据库的数据访问操作。
总结:
ASP连接MySQL远程服务器是一种实现动态web应用程序的常见技术方案。在连接MySQL远程服务器时,用户需获取有效的MySQL连接字符串,使用ADODB对象连接MySQL数据库,并通过ASP代码执行SQL语句进行数据访问操作。以上,就是关于ASP连接MySQL远程服务器的技术实现分析,希望能够对读者有所帮助。